I have to disagree with you here. I've been a bills fan for a long time and followed this draft intently. They traded up to get Losman because Green Bay or St. Louis was going to get him. Think about it this way: They traded a 2nd and 5th this year and a 1st next year. They were going to need a QB next year so in a sense they gave up there 1st next year (which they would have used on a QB anyway in a much weaker class) and their 2nd and 5th are pretty much used on getting the qb they wanted and giving him a year's experiance under bledsoe learning buffalo's system. Pretty smart move if you ask me. As for Losman, he is extremely smart person, check out his wonderlic score, he scored quite well compared to the other qb's. As for his attitude, i think a qb needs a little ' i think i'm the best swagger' Dan Marino had it, Jim Kelly had it among many other's. Qb's need to be able to chew out their team mates when they f*ck up and also be man enough to take the blame for their own mistakes, that's what Losman brings to the table. Whether he pan's out or not, who know's, but i like him and think he will be really good IMO.
